How they compare
Peru currently reports 4.19 against 3.82 in Samoa, a difference of 0.37.
That makes Peru's figure about 1.1 times Samoa's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 35 shared years of data; in 1990 it was Samoa ahead.
Peru ranks 115th and Samoa ranks 117th of 201 countries.
Across the 4 decades both report, Peru averaged higher in 1 and Samoa in 3.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Peru | Samoa |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 7.99 | 12.85 | 4.86 | Samoa |
| 2000s | 4.99 | 7.46 | 2.48 | Samoa |
| 2010s | 3.99 | 4.56 | 0.5762 | Samoa |
| 2020s | 4.24 | 3.88 | 0.3628 | Peru |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
